Saint Kitts became home to the first Caribbean British and French colonies in the mid-1620s. Along with the island of Nevis, Saint Kitts was a member of the British West Indies until gaining independence on 19 September 1983.

The capital of the two-island nation, and also its largest port, is the town of Basseterre on Saint Kitts. There is a modern facility for handling large cruise ships there. A ring road goes around the perimeter of the island with smaller roads branching off it; the interior of the island is too steep for habitation.

Some of the landmarks and points of interest in Basseterre are Independence Square, the Circus, St. George's Anglican Church, Basseterre Co-Cathedral of Immaculate Conception, the Cenotaph, the National Museum of Saint Kitts, Amina Craft Market and Public Market.

Tourism is a major and growing source of income to the island, although the number and density of resorts is less than on many other Caribbean islands.
